    Mary Cassatt painted this self-portrait, one of only two known, a year after Edgar Degas invited her to exhibit with the Impressionists. His influence is apparent in the unusual sage-green background, the attention to contrasting complementary colors, and the figure’s daring and casual asymmetrical pose.

    Exhibition Label Mary Cassatt created this watercolor, one of her few self-portraits, around 1880, a year after she began exhibiting her work with the French impressionists. Cassatt used her art to address the many roles of the modern woman-as mother, as intellectual, and here, as professional artist.

    Mary Cassatt American In 1891, Cassatt exhibited a set of ten color prints at the Galerie Durand-Ruel, Paris. All depict women engaged in everyday activities, with four using mirrors to extend and complicate the pictorial space.
